Abstract

The aim of our research is to study how parents, teachers and students envisage street children in two state schools located in the municipality of Bom Jesus/PI, in the south of the state, abundant in water, rich in agriculture in the Northeastern region of Brazil. Even though the city presents economic growth, according to politicians, it is still within those that are socio-economically excluded. The theoretical and methodological foundation of our work will rely on studies undertaken by authors such as Zoran Roca, Vicente Celestino in what concerns this same theme in their places of origin and, concerning children living in the streets we shall study Antônia Lima, Maria Vidigal as well as guidelines provided by the book Integrated Policies for the guarantee of rights (PAICA-RUA Org., 2002).These were the studies that allowed us to understand the situation of these street children, their families and the action of the school and society towards them. We decided for qualitative research because, through the interviews, questionnaires and drawings it was possible for us to detect the severe reality of these children’s daily lives. On analyzing the situation of these children we concluded that it is caused by a socio-economic and family problem, which affects a small part of the population that is socially excluded, without hope of recovery, for these children consider themselves to be discriminated, humiliated, but autonomous, limitless, without order. We see through the vision of the agents mentioned in this research, in the interviews, questionnaires and drawings, on the one hand, just how difficult life is for these outcast children due to the most varied problems and, on the other, they cry out for “help” so that is will be possible to rescue these children and provide them better and more just social conditions.
